aboutsummaryrefslogtreecommitdiffstats
path: root/osdf/adapters/aaf/sms.py
diff options
context:
space:
mode:
authorDileep Ranganathan <dileep.ranganathan@intel.com>2018-10-12 02:29:49 -0700
committerDileep Ranganathan <dileep.ranganathan@intel.com>2018-10-19 04:55:34 -0700
commitc3aa7ebbb6f17c93958103077614f5bdac9837b0 (patch)
tree5688c63850524dabe9eba9cd96cf29df3cd91279 /osdf/adapters/aaf/sms.py
parent8d495104b8174cdc19b4bf27b98d9b4210fec01f (diff)
Enable SMS in OSDF
Load secrets from SMS in OSDF. Removed secrets from osdf_config.yaml. Unit tests to use the test/config/osdf_config.yaml. Helm charts uses a Job to load secrets. CSIT needs to load it using the preload tool provided by SMS. Change-Id: I0f832033476c02958f6392abba74e4d5a36cc902 Issue-ID: OPTFRA-343 Signed-off-by: Dileep Ranganathan <dileep.ranganathan@intel.com>
Diffstat (limited to 'osdf/adapters/aaf/sms.py')
-rw-r--r--osdf/adapters/aaf/sms.py4
1 files changed, 4 insertions, 0 deletions
diff --git a/osdf/adapters/aaf/sms.py b/osdf/adapters/aaf/sms.py
index 9c7af51..25ae7f2 100644
--- a/osdf/adapters/aaf/sms.py
+++ b/osdf/adapters/aaf/sms.py
@@ -21,6 +21,8 @@
from onapsmsclient import Client
+import osdf.config.base as cfg_base
+import osdf.config.credentials as creds
import osdf.config.loader as config_loader
from osdf.config.base import osdf_config
from osdf.logging.osdf_logging import debug_log
@@ -98,6 +100,8 @@ def load_secrets():
config['pciHMSPassword'] = secret_dict['pciHMS']['Password']
config['osdfPCIOptUsername'] = secret_dict['osdfPCIOpt']['UserName']
config['osdfPCIOptPassword'] = secret_dict['osdfPCIOpt']['Password']
+ cfg_base.http_basic_auth_credentials = creds.load_credentials(osdf_config)
+ cfg_base.dmaap_creds = creds.dmaap_creds()
def delete_secrets():